Footage of a terrifying fire in a London restaurant has emerged, showing diners rushing out of the venue. You can watch the clip below; some readers may find the footage distressing:

MNKY HSE London - popular amongst the Love Island celebs - is a Latin American fine dining restaurant in Mayfair.

Social media footage shows a horrifying blaze rip through the restaurant while customers frantically rush out of the venue.

Three hundred people were evacuated by staff at the restaurant, while five fire engines and around 35 firefighters attended the scene.

A man and a woman were also treated by the ambulance on site.

"Firefighters were called to a fire at a restaurant on Dover Street in Mayfair," the London Fire Brigade said.

"Christmas decorations inside the building were alight and had been extinguished before firefighters arrived.

"Around 300 people were evacuated by on-site staff and crews carried out a systematic search of the property to ensure no one was inside on arrival.

"A man and a woman were treated on scene by London Ambulance Service crews.

"Dover Street was closed whilst crews worked to make the scene safe.

"The Brigade was called at 2140 and the incident was over for firefighters by 2218.

"Five fire engines and around 35 firefighters from Soho, Lambeth, Kensington and Chelsea fire stations attended the scene.

"The cause of the fire is under investigation."

LADbible has contacted MNKY HSE for comment.

MNKY HSE [Monkey House] - is a contemporary Latin American restaurant and bar hidden behind a discreet entrance at no 10 Dover Street.
